Figbar Norwich: A Modern Dessert Bar Celebrated as a Good Food Guide Local Gem

Figbar introduces Norwich's first dedicated dessert bar, anchoring a modern meeting place where pastry chef and owner Jaime Garbutt's creations take centre stage.

The Chef and the Kitchen

Garbutt brings extensive experience from Michelin-starred kitchens including Pétrus, Morston Hall, and Ottolenghi before founding Figbar in 2016. His approach prioritises rigorous testing, ensuring every item meets exacting standards rather than relying on shortcuts. The team produces everything on-site, from morning pastries to evening plated desserts, maintaining full control over quality and flavour profiles throughout the day.

Seasonal Flavours and Signature Sweets

The menu shifts regularly, offering guests a rotating selection of inventive sweets alongside classic bakes. Current highlights include the Salted Miso Chocolate Cake served with yoghurt sorbet and the Chocolate Gianduja paired with hazelnuts and salted miso ice cream. Patrons can also order playful constructions like the Popcorn Gone Bananas or the Peanut Parfait layered with salted caramel and Nutella. The Good Food Guide notes specific favourites such as the glossy "Jaffa cake" sponges and a rich chocolate and Guinness cake finished with coffee buttercream icing.

The Dessert Bar Experience

Positioned near the theatre district, Figbar functions as both a pre-show destination and a late-night treat, staying open until 10pm on Thursday through Saturday evenings. Visitors encounter a counter displaying an array of cakes and bakes, with a separate refrigerated case holding ready-to-go options for those preferring a takeaway portion. The space encourages lingering over a coffee after dinner or grabbing a boxed selection to enjoy elsewhere. This flexible model supports the venue's reputation as a local gem where sweet cravings are met without the formality of a traditional restaurant finish.

The Good Food Guide — Local Gem

Handily placed for the theatre, this idiosyncratic set-up is billed as Norwich's first 'dessert bar'. Everything is made on the premises by pastry chef Jaime Garbutt (ex-Morston Hall et al) and his team, from the counter laden with cakes and bakes to a fridge stacked with desserts to go. You’ll be tempted by delights such as the ‘Jaffa cake’ sponges with a glossy chocolate ganache swirl or the deliciously moist chocolate and Guinness cake with coffee buttercream icing – so eat in with a coffee or have a selection boxed up to take out. Open Thursday-Saturday only, but conveniently until 10pm – to satisfy that craving for something sweet.
